Welcome to Basel, Switzerland, home to Syngenta. In this picturesque city located along the banks of the Rhine River, you’ll find the headquarters to a company that extends its reach to more than 90 countries around the world with its more than 26,000 employees.

Although the company in its present form was created in late 2000 when Novartis and AstraZeneca merged their agribusinesses, its parent company roots stretch back well over 200 years. In fact, the company can trace its roots to Geigy, which was formed in 1758.

Today’s Syngenta is much more than an agricultural chemical company. Although its core business includes herbicides, insecticides and fungicides, the company has made huge strides in field crops, vegetables, flowers, seed care, and lawn and garden products.
